The New Kid may be appearing in the show!
Yep, believe it or not, I found a Podcast where Trey and Matt get interviewed by IGN:
http://www.ign.com/articles/2015/06/24/ ... -interview
In addition to providing a few more details about the upcoming Fractured But Whole game, Trey and Matt have said in the podcast that they're considering the idea of making the New Kid an official character in the show.
Yep, you heard right.
Personally, I think it's a great idea, not only would it mean that Stick of Truth and Fractured But Whole will be official additions to the South Park canon, but I think there's a lot of potential in how they can portray the New Kid as a character.
Think about it, you got a quiet nine-year-old boy who, while arguably submissive to a fault, has gained huge in-universe popularity to the point of befriending the majority of the people of South Park and has an extraordinary talent for combat. Which may make him ideal for if Trey and Matt plan on adding a Parody Sue esique character to their stories.
And it's not like he hasn't got any clearly established relationships with certain canon characters, Stick of Truth has heavily established that New KID seems to consider Butters his best friend out of the 250 friends he's made, which can serve as a potential plot point, and if Cartman and Kyle's interactions with him are any indication, New Kid may find himself prone to being pulled in the middle of their arguments, essentially making Kyle and Cartman into being like divorced parents toward the New Kid, or something like that.
At least, that's how I imagine he'd turn out upon appearing in the show, but what do you guys think?
